Comprehending Mental Health Assessment
A mental health assessment is a structured process that involves examining an individual's emotional, psychological, and social well-being to recognize mental illness. The assessment aims to understand the client's issues and establish an effective treatment plan.
Key Components of Mental Health Assessment
A comprehensive mental health assessment normally consists of the following elements:

Clinical Interview: The very first action where the mental health professional gathers details about the customer's history, signs, and life circumstances.

Behavioral Observations: Professionals observe the client's behavior throughout the assessment to collect insights into their emotion.

Standardized Tests and Questionnaires: These are used to quantify the seriousness of symptoms and compare them to normative information.

Diagnostic Criteria: Utilizing handbooks such as the DSM-5 (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ders), specialists identify specific mental health issues based on reported signs and behavior.

Risk Assessment: This involves evaluating whether the specific poses a danger to themselves or others, especially in cases of suicidal ideation or self-harm.

Counseling is a therapeutic process where people engage with an experienced mental health professional to attend to personal, social, or psychological difficulties. It is an essential element of mental healthcare that matches assessment and diagnosis.
Types of Counseling Approaches
Numerous therapeutic techniques can be employed in counseling, each with its own techniques and philosophies:

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T): Focuses on determining and altering negative thought patterns and habits.

Psychodynamic Therapy: Explores unconscious inspirations and past experiences to comprehend existing habits.

Humanistic Therapy: Emphasizes individual growth and self-actualization, enabling clients to explore their sensations in a supportive environment.

Household Therapy: Addresses household characteristics and relationships, concentrating on enhancing interaction and dealing with conflicts.

Group Therapy: Involves a little group of people interacting under the guidance of a therapist to share experiences and offer support.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Why is mental health assessment crucial?
A mental health assessment is essential for early detection of issues, helping to customize treatment plans that can substantially enhance a person's quality of life.
2. What can I anticipate during a mental health assessment?
Individuals can expect a structured interview, different tests or questionnaires, and a conversation about their mental health history. It might also include assessments of danger aspects.
3. How long does counseling last?
The duration of counseling differs depending on specific requirements, the specific problems being resolved, and the goals set in between the counselor and the client. Sessions usually last from a couple of weeks to numerous months.
4. Can anyone gain from mental health counseling?
Absolutely. Counseling can be helpful for anyone dealing with emotional difficulties, tension, relationship problems, or seeking individual growth.
5. Is mental health counseling confidential?
Yes, mental health counseling is private, with legal and ethical guidelines guaranteeing the privacy of the customer's information.
